Output 1ba52212fc06b40c18693619816b525b1870945c5499768ec61b9a4c2c365767:0

value
157011
script pubkey
OP_0 OP_PUSHBYTES_20 17fea00958944ab95062c7dd8a47a934ac64f181
address
bc1qzll2qz2cj39tj5rzclwc53afxjkxfuvptd2hsv
transaction
1ba52212fc06b40c18693619816b525b1870945c5499768ec61b9a4c2c365767
confirmations
108334
spent
true